SUMMIT, N.J. & HOUSTON & PORTLAND, Ore.--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Energy Capital Partners (“ECP") today announced that it has acquired Triple Oak Power ("Triple Oak") from EnCap Energy Transition Fund I (“EnCap") and its co-investors, Yorktown Partners and Mercuria Energy.
Founded in 2020 and headquartered in Portland, Oregon, Triple Oak, through greenfield development and acquisitions, develops and monetizes high-quality renewable energy projects to accelerate the U.S. transition to renewable energy and help shape a more diverse, reliable, and sustainable power grid. Led by an executive team with deep experience leading some of the country’s largest renewable companies, Triple Oak manages a pipeline of more than 8.0GW of renewable development projects, comprised of predominantly utility-scale wind opportunities in the central and western United States.

Marathon Capital acted as the exclusive financial advisor to EnCap and Triple Oak on the transaction, and Sidley Austin LLP served as legal counsel to EnCap and Triple Oak. Latham & Watkins, LLP served as legal advisor to ECP. Financial details of the transaction were not disclosed.
ECP, founded in 2005, is a leading investor across energy transition, electrification and decarbonization infrastructure assets. The ECP team, comprised of 88 people with over 600 years of collective industry experience, deep expertise and extensive relationships, has consummated more than 60 transactions over the last 10 years, representing more than $45 billion of enterprise value. Since 1988, EnCap Investments has been the leading provider of venture capital to the independent sector of the U.S. energy industry. The firm has raised 25 institutional investment funds totaling approximately $41 billion and currently manages capital on behalf of more than 350 U.S. and international investors. Founded in 2019, the EnCap Energy Transition platform is led by four Managing Partners, each with 30-35 years of experience in the development and operations of renewables and power generation.
